Polestar 3 enhanced with new features and complimentary hardware upgrade

Polestar is continuing with its commitment to comprehensively update the Polestar 3 throughout its lifecycle. Since delivering the first customer Polestar 3 in June 2024, the Swedish brand has implemented nine software updates to its flagship SUV, while across its three-car range it has delivered over 30 OTA software updates since launching the Polestar 2 in 2020.

This most recent OTA software update for the Polestar 3, the first software-defined vehicle from Europe, adds additional features such as walk-away locking and digital key functionality for selected devices.

Polestar digital key functionality allows smartphone users to enjoy the convenience of unlocking, locking or starting their vehicle while leaving their phone in their pocket. Polestar 3 customers can now enjoy the convenience and added benefits of their car keys in Apple Wallet. Drivers can automatically unlock or lock, and start their vehicle while leaving their iPhone in their pocket or by simply wearing their Apple Watch.

Customers will have the ability to share car keys in Apple Wallet through Messages, Mail, AirDrop, WhatsApp, and more with up to 5 other users, and vehicle owners can also decide whether these additional users are able to gain access to their vehicle or have the ability to drive it. Power Reserve allows users to utilize their car keys in Apple Wallet to access and start their vehicle, even if the iPhone needs to be charged.

Polestar digital key functionality can be shared between Android and iOS platforms.

Michael Lohscheller, Polestar CEO, says, “With our over-the-air updates we can continue to make our cars better over time, and with the latest updates for Polestar 3 and Polestar 4 we’ve done just that. Our customers asked for digital key functionality, and so we delivered, and we’ll continue to add value for our customers over the lifetime of their cars.”

OTA updates aren’t limited to additional applications, features or greater software stability but can also include changes to driving attributes and active safety systems. Thanks to its centralised core computing system, Polestar 3 offers even greater possibilities for comprehensive updates.

For model year 2026 the Polestar 3 will be delivered with an upgrade from its current -generation NVIDIA DRIVE AGX Xavier processor to a new, more powerful, NVIDIA DRIVE AGX Orin processor.

Crucially, this hardware update, which will bring with it even greater computing power, will also be offered to all existing Polestar 3 customers as a complimentary upgrade, staying true to the Swedish brand’s promise to continue to add value and deliver the very best user experience to its customers.

Michael Lohscheller, Polestar CEO, continues, “Polestar 3, the first software-defined vehicle from Europe, gets even more brain power. The ability to upgrade the hardware of our cars when new technologies become available is the perfect demonstration of our commitment to deliver the very best ownership experience to our customers. With the Orin processor upgrade, the already outstanding Polestar 3 gets even better.”

This complimentary hardware change will be performed at a Polestar authorised service point, and customers will be contacted when the NVIDIA DRIVE AGX Orin processor is available to be fitted.
